Purple Bull concern response to Isack Hadjar demand after let-down Australian GP debut consequence

Isack Hadjar’s very good qualifying show meant nothing after heartbreak within the Grand Prix.

Isack Hadjar’s engine failure ruined what had been a wonderful weekend (Picture: Getty)

Purple Bull hope they’ve lastly discovered the fitting associate for Max Verstappen after an outstanding efficiency on debut from Isack Hajdar. The 21-year-old ended the weekend pointless due to an engine failure however his efficiency as much as that time had caught the attention. He certified third, slower solely than the 2 dominant Mercedes vehicles, whereas underneath the added strain of being the one Purple Bull driver gunning for pole after Verstappen’s Q1 crash.

And a powerful launch off the road noticed him problem for the lead earlier than dropping out to the Ferraris and pole-sitter George Russell. Regardless of the bitter ending to his weekend, Hadjar gave Purple Bull hope that they’ve lastly discovered somebody who can cope with the strain of partnering Verstappen, after a string of failed appointments.

Crew principal Laurent Mekies has hailed his fellow Frenchman’s “incredible weekend”. He mentioned: “He got here right here from the very first lap, FP1, Friday, on the fitting tempo. We had been capable of cut up the testing programme between the vehicles, get double the quantity of knowledge.

“He went to qualifying with the whole lot, meaning a primary time qualifying with these guidelines, completely nailed it. Put the automotive in P3, which might be as excessive because it might have been on Saturday. He was on his strategy to have a mega begin earlier than he realised we did not have the battery cost and I feel the tempo would have been ok to struggle with the McLaren.”

Although the engine failure rendered it irrelevant, Hadjar was pissed off on the lack of battery energy to assist him firstly of the race. “I had an excellent launch, I used to be taking the lead straightforward,” he mentioned. “And as soon as I assumed, ‘Oh, I will take the lead’, no extra energy – in order that was nice.

“However the engine sounded horrible, so I knew I used to be not going to complete the race. I felt nice, zero errors the entire weekend. I really feel very snug and it is a disgrace. I want I might have been on observe combating for third.”

Mekies was sorry to have let down his new driver and admitted Purple Bull wanted to do higher. He mentioned: “It is our duty to keep away from that scenario. We now have been caught by some limitations of the best way you possibly can cost and discharge the battery within the formation lap. If we’re the one ones who’ve been caught by that, it implies that we’ve got not carried out an excellent job. So, it is what it’s.

“Principally, with the weird behaviours that drivers must have on a formation lap, with acceleration, braking, acceleration, braking to heat your brakes, to heat your tyres, and so on, we ended up in some extent the place we had been unable anymore to get to the fitting state of cost for the race begin. We needed to construct up that battery stage via the primary lap, which clearly was not gratifying.”
